Once a girl who had to do many jobs to make a living, comedian Kieu Linh is now a hotel owner in Da Lat and runs a dog rescue center. After her divorce, she chose to live alone and made a will at the age of 44 as a way to prepare for the future.
Kieu Linh was born in 1981 in Ho Chi Minh City. Before becoming a famous comedian, she had a difficult time making a living. She came from a well-off family, but economic turmoil forced Kieu Linh to become independent at a very young age. She worked as a waitress, supermarket saleswoman, coffee seller... to make ends meet.
During the day she works, at night she attends theater training classes. It is these experiences that have created a Kieu Linh who is confident, emotional and has depth in each role. She started her relationship with the comedy stage from supporting roles, gradually affirming her name through a series of skits and television shows such as "Tan Phong Nu Si", "Cuoc Goi Uon Oo", "Duyen Don Mien Tay", "Loi Song Vo Sai Mis"...
With more than two decades of artistic activities, Kieu Linh has left an impression on the audience with the image of a charming comedian, without scandals, always dedicated to her profession. She is a familiar face on many big stages such as Nu Cuoi Moi, Kich Sai Gon, Kich Hong Van... and often appears in Tet comedy shows and TV game shows.
Kieu Linh's special features are her characteristic husky voice, small but energetic figure. She not only acts as a comedian but also tries her hand at the role of director, screenwriter and content producer. "I don't want to just stand on stage, I want to understand and master the whole creative process," she once shared.
In recent years, Kieu Linh has rarely appeared in art programs. She only occasionally participates in projects of close colleagues, most recently a small role in the movie "Mai" by Tran Thanh (2024) and the upcoming "Nha Gia Tien" by Huynh Lap.
In a conversation with the press, Kieu Linh said she has limited her artistic activities to focus on business. After many ups and downs, the actress wants to spend time for herself and enjoy a peaceful life. "I no longer have the pressure of making a living. Now I act not for money, but because I miss my job," she said.
Despite appearing less, Kieu Linh still maintains a close relationship with her juniors in the profession. With Tran Thanh and Huynh Lap â young artists she loves â Kieu Linh always tries to appear, even if it is just a small role. "I want to have memories with them, and also a way to thank the audience who have loved me for many years," she said.
After a long time without acting, Kieu Linh admitted that she had difficulty returning, especially remembering her lines. After the COVID-19 pandemic, she suffered from memory loss, making learning lines more difficult. But for her, every time she stands in front of the camera is a time to relive her passion.
Currently, Kieu Linh lives in Ho Chi Minh City but often travels between three places: Saigon, Da Lat and Ba Ria - Vung Tau. She runs a small hotel in Da Lat and a dog rescue center with more than 300 abandoned dogs in Vung Tau. Her business takes up most of her time, forcing her to turn down many invitations to act in movies.
When she first opened the rescue center, Kieu Linh had to invest all her savings. "It was difficult, but this was my wish and my mission," she shared. Even though she had no children, Kieu Linh was still able to "become a mother" to hundreds of dogs. "If God did not give me a child, I would accept four-legged children," she said.
Many people advised her to adopt a child so that she would have someone to take care of her when she was old, but Kieu Linh refused. For her, children are not old-age insurance. "If you are filial, you will take care of your parents yourself. But don't put pressure on them. Each person has to take care of themselves," she shared.
In 2008, Kieu Linh married artist Mai Son â her teacher and companion in the profession. They were 20 years apart in age and were once an admired couple in Vietnamese showbiz. However, after 12 years of living together, they decided to divorce. Without children together, without fuss, they chose to part ways with respect.
At the time of their divorce, the two had disagreements that seemed unforgivable. But after the COVID-19 pandemic, Kieu Linh changed her mind, wanting to let go of all conflicts to live in peace. Currently, she and Mai Son consider each other as soul mates. "Mr. Son still helps me with big things in life that women find difficult to do. We are no longer husband and wife, but friends and colleagues," she shared.
Mai Son currently lives in Da Lat, helping Kieu Linh manage the hotel. His two children also live with her. They still go out to eat, watch movies, and even travel together â but "each stays in their own room and each goes home." For Kieu Linh, it's a gentle, non-binding form of care.
At the age of 44, Kieu Linh has already made a will. She clearly plans her assets for herself, her family and a part for charity work. "I am a far-sighted person. I am not afraid of death, I am only afraid of what I have built being abandoned," she said.
She shared that making a will was not a pessimistic act, but a proactive one. "I want everything to be clear. If one day I am no longer here, the rescue center will still have to continue. I don't want anyone to have to struggle because of me," she added.
Kieu Linhâs biggest wish right now is to have the health to continue working. Besides business, she still wants to return to art if there is a suitable project. In addition, she cherishes the idea of implementing a charity program to help those in difficult circumstances, without children â a wish she has kept throughout her decades in the profession.
"I used to be someone who had nothing, so I understand the feeling of being abandoned and deprived. I want to do something to help people like me," she said.
